If your trailer’s old brakes are dragging or not stopping like they should, this DeeMaxx kit gives you a major upgrade. The 13-1/8" slip-on rotors fit right over standard idler hubs and are held in place by your existing wheel bolts—no need to replace the whole hub-and-rotor assembly. The included Alpha G1600 actuator delivers up to 1,600 psi of hydraulic pressure from your in-cab brake controller for fast, smooth braking with no lag or surge. It’s a solid way to get automotive-grade control on a tandem-axle setup rated for 7,000 lbs per axle.
Towing or launching in salty or wet conditions can destroy unprotected parts fast. This kit’s Maxx coating on the rotors, calipers, and brackets has a salt-spray rating of over 1,000 hours—far beyond zinc or Dacromet coatings. Drainage holes in the rotor hat section help water escape and further cut down on rust. That means you spend more time towing and less time fighting corrosion.

Hauling weight or driving long grades builds heat that can fade brakes quickly. DeeMaxx vented rotors move air through the core to shed heat faster while Kevlar pads resist wear and dissipate heat evenly. The stainless steel piston delivers responsive braking even when hot, helping you maintain control during heavy stops or downhill runs.
DIYers will appreciate how straightforward this system is to set up. The slip-on rotors and bolt-on brackets make mounting easy, and the included rubber hydraulic lines meet DOT and SAE standards while being simpler to route than rigid steel lines. When it’s time for maintenance, laser-etched bleeding instructions on the back of each caliper mean you always have guidance on hand without needing to dig for a manual.

DeeMaxx brakes are the only trailer brakes to pass the SAE J2681 automotive brake test for friction performance. The patented caliper bolt design keeps sleeves secure and reduces wear, while high-grade materials extend service life. The kit carries a 7-year warranty on the brakes and a 2-year warranty on the actuator—proof it’s built for dependable stopping season after season.
